Tomorrow is public holiday

The Ministry of Local Government and Rural Development has announced that tomorrow, December 26, is a public holiday this year; hence, the public should observe the day as such.

The ministry made the announcement in a statement containing approved 2015 public holidays in Malawi which does not include December 26 2015 as a public holiday. The statement has been signed by the ministry’s principal secretary Kester Kaphaizi on Monday.

December 26, popularly known as Boxing Day, was delisted from the list of public holidays by former president the late Bingu wa Mutharika on the basis that the country had too many holidays most of which were counterproductive.

However, the day was restored as a public holiday again in 2012 by Mutharika’s successor and his former estranged Vice-President Joyce Banda.
